Franklin township, Lenawee County, Michigan Demographics

The total population of Franklin township is estimated to be 3,064 with 1,622 males (52.94%) and 1,442 females (47.06%). There are 180 less females than males in Franklin township.
The median household income in Franklin township was $85,638 in 2021, which marked an an increase of 4,818(5.96%) from $80,820 in 2020. This income is 114.79% of the U.S. median household income of $74,606 (all incomes in 2022 inflation-adjusted dollars).
Per the latest American Community Survey by the Census Bureau, Franklin township sees its highest median household income among householders in the age group of 25 to 44 years old, at $121,104. Overall, the median household income for the township of Franklin township stands at $85,638.
In Franklin township, the median income for all workers aged 15 years and older, regardless of work hours, was $46,597 for males and $27,947 for females. However, when specifically considering full-time, year-round workers within the same age group, the median income was $79,417 for males and $60,281 for females.
In Franklin township, population is primarily represented by White households, reporting a median income of $85,539.
In 2022, the population of Franklin township was 3,043, a 0.46% decrease year-by-year from 2021. Previously, in 2021, Franklin township's population was 3,057, a decline of 0.10% compared to a population of 3,060 in 2020.
The median age in Franklin township, Lenawee County, Michigan is 49.7, as per 2021 ACS 5-Year Estimates. Of the total population, 12.78% were under the age of 15, 15.65% aged 15 to 29, 52.93% aged 30 to 64, 17.08% aged 65 to 84, and 1.56% were 85 years of age and older.
Racial distribution of Franklin township population: 95.76% are White, 0.52% are Asian and 3.72% are multiracial.
